Binance Coin Mildly Down as Total Amount of BNB Burned Surpasses $3 Million

BNB

Total amount of BNB burned has already surpassed $3 million

According to BurnBNB data, the total amount of BNB burned is now over $ 3 million. Binance Coin (BNB) is down slightly today compared to the rest of the altcoin market. In the past 24 hours, the majority of altcoin tokens have suffered notable losses of between 10% and 30%.

On Nov. 30, Binance Smart Chain went through one of the most extensive upgrades since its inception. Dubbed Bruno Upgrade v1.1.5 (also known as the BEP-95 upgrade), the hard fork introduced a real-time burn mechanism for BNB token.

The latest update from BurnBNB, the BNB token burn tracking bot, shows that 6,100 BNB – valued at $ 3,655,350 – have been burned since the BEP real-time burn upgrade. 95, which assigns a fixed ratio of Binance Coin collected by each validator to burn. .

Binance Coin began with an initial supply of 200 million tokens, but due to regular coin burn events, the supply is gradually decreasing. This figure currently stands at $166.8 million, according to data from CoinMarketCap.

BNB is currently trading down 3% for the day at $ 541. BNB’s market capitalization is currently $ 90.4 billion, remaining the third largest cryptocurrency behind Ethereum (ETH).
